#ee4ea0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ee4ea0 is composed of 93.3% red, 30.6%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 329.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 62%. #ee4ea0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#dd0041.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#ee4ea0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ee4ea0 has RGB values of R:238, G:78,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.33,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15617696.

Hex triplet ee4ea0 #ee4ea0
RGB Decimal 238, 78, 160 rgb(238,78,160)
RGB Percent 93.3, 30.6, 62.7 rgb(93.3%,30.6%,62.7%)
CMYK 0, 67, 33, 7
HSL 329.3°, 82.5, 62 hsl(329.3,82.5%,62%)
HSV (or HSB) 329.3°, 67.2, 93.3
Web Safe ff6699 #ff6699
CIE-LAB 58.196, 67.943, -10.336
XYZ 44.33, 26.168, 35.972
xyY 0.416, 0.246, 26.168
CIE-LCH 58.196, 68.725, 351.35
CIE-LUV 58.196, 96.58, -27.25
Hunter-Lab 51.155, 65.166, -5.885
Binary 11101110, 01001110, 10100000

Shades and Tints of #ee4ea0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ee4ea0 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#878787 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9c7c8c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8090c6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9c8d98 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ea656b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a878b8 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b9769b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#eb5d7e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
